KVM(Kernel-based Virtual Machine)是一种开源的虚拟化技术,可以使得用户能够在一台物理服务器上同时运行多个虚拟机。KVM技术基于Linux内核,因此在安装KVM之前需要先安装Linux操作系统。

在本文中,我们将介绍如何在Linux系统上安装KVM虚拟化技术,以及其中的一些关键步骤。

首先,确保您的Linux系统已经安装了适当的软件包。在大多数Linux发行版中,KVM软件包已经默认包含在系统中,但是如果您的系统中没有安装KVM软件包,您可以通过以下命令进行安装:

```
sudo apt-get update
sudo apt-get install qemu-kvm libvirt-clients libvirt-daemon-system bridge-utils
```

上述命令将会更新系统软件包列表,并安装KVM虚拟化所需的软件包。

接下来,启动libvirt守护进程以确保KVM的正常运行。您可以通过以下命令启动libvirt守护进程:

```
sudo systemctl start libvirtd
sudo systemctl enable libvirtd
```

现在,您已经成功安装和启动KVM虚拟化技术。接下来,您可以使用virt-manager等图形界面工具来管理虚拟机,或者通过命令行工具virsh进行管理。

在使用KVM技术创建虚拟机时,您可以选择使用预先准备好的镜像文件,或者手动安装操作系统。通过KVM,您可以为每个虚拟机分配独立的硬件资源,如CPU核心、内存和磁盘空间,以实现不同应用的隔离运行。

总的来说,KVM虚拟化技术为用户提供了一种灵活、高效且成本低廉的虚拟化解决方案。通过安装KVM并创建虚拟机,用户可以在单台物理服务器上运行多个操作系统实例,提高了硬件资源的利用率,减少了硬件设备的成本开销。

在未来,随着云计算和大数据技术的快速发展,KVM虚拟化技术将会越来越受到用户的关注和青睐。通过不断优化和改进,KVM将进一步提升虚拟化技术的性能和稳定性,为用户提供更加便捷和高效的虚拟化环境。